#d541be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d541be is composed of 83.5% red, 25.5%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.5% magenta, 10.8%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 309.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 54.5%. #d541be color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#ab007d.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d541be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d541be has RGB values of R:213, G:65,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.11,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13975998.

Shades and Tints of #d541be
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d541be
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e888d is the less saturated color, while #f91dd7 is the most saturated one.
